Re-emphasis on the prevention of fusarium wilt

The prevention and treatment of the wilt disease in melon land is an important measure to seize the yield and income of the western melon. In the cultivation of melons, appropriate control measures can be taken to reduce the damage of wilt disease.
First, we must seriously disinfect the seeds. The seeds are soaked with 500-fold solution of phenylephthalate wettable powder 500 times or 50% carbendazim wettable powder 500 times for 1 hour or soaked in hot water of 55-60 degrees C for 7-8 minutes before sowing, and then transferred to about 30 degrees C. Soaking in warm water kills germs on the surface and in the seeds. Disinfection is 4-6% less than in unsterilized fields.
Second, we must use grafted seedlings. Using hyacinth and pumpkin roots with resistance to wilt disease, Western melon seedlings grafted on pumpkin or gourd and other rootstocks can effectively prevent the occurrence of the wilt disease, thus reducing the diseases of the heavy melon land.
Third, use thermal insulation cultivation. To promote ridges and ridges with high ridges and double-film cultivation can effectively control blight. According to field surveys in recent years, sorghum more than 15 centimeters long, and then covered with mulching, plus a small arch cultivation, can be planted early 15-20 days, promote flowering and fruit setting period in late May to early June, before the arrival of the rainy season , can reduce the incidence of wilt disease 8-18%.
Fourth, use formula fertilization. Throughout the entire growth period, formula fertilization and application of potash fertilizer increased the ability of plants to resist wilt disease. Therefore, in the cultivation of melons in the West, it is advisable to do more organic fertilizer with less fertilizer and less application of chemical fertilizers. It is advisable to use 100-150 kilograms of cooked cakes with Mushi or 3 farmyard fertilizers. Topdressing fertilizers with P and K fertilizers or special compound fertilizers for melons, with less N fertilization, in the fruit setting period, 30-40 kg of special compound fertilizer per mu or 15 kg of potassium sulfate plus 15 kg of superphosphate, plus 5-8 kg of urea should.
Fifth, in the open film of watermelon, combined with pouring root water when transplanting, with 800-1000 times the strong chlorine solution irrigation, and use slaked lime sprinkled around the seedlings after the cover film. The alkaline reaction of the surface soil around the seedlings can reduce the occurrence of diseases.
Sixth, use early defense measures. Before the colonization, the soil was applied with a hole, and the pesticide soil was formulated with a ratio of 1:100 using benzenelite, thiophanate-methyl, and double-acting agents. Apply to the planting hole. Mu 1.25 kilograms of medication. At the early stage of disease, use 80% dexanaxone 50 g plus 15% triadimefon 20 g or 75% chlorothalonil 50 g plus 15% triadimefon 20 g diluted 30 kg evenly. At the same time with the agricultural anti-120 plus double effect Ling plus bacteria clear 400 times liquid Irrigation root, each strain of drug liquid about 0.25 kg. Continuous spray, rooting 2-3 times, have better control effect. (Hubei Dangyang Agricultural 110 Service Center)
